WebbA morpheme is the essential unit in word construction, the smallest meaningful component of language which conveys message containing meaning or function O’Grady and Guzman, 1996:133. While according to Allan 2001: 108, a morpheme is the smallest unit of syntactic analysis with semantic specification. Webbsmallest meaningful unit in language. Morphemes are the minimal linguistic units with lexical or grammatical meaning (Booij, 2005, pp. 8). In addition, Katamba (1993, pp. 20) defines that morphemes refer to the smallest, inseparable unit of sematic content or grammatical function which words are made up by.

Webb14 juni 2013 · 糸 is the smallest meaningful component in the above kanji. Since radicals are parts of a kanji, they are also formed by combining strokes. A kanji has two separate pronunciations, 音読み (onyomi, chinese reading) and 訓読み (kunyomi, Japanese reading). Sometimes a kanji has only On reading but no Kun reading.
